We will continue to share our economic experience – Korean Ambassador to Kazakhstan

25 September, 2019 13:50

The Kazakh capital, Nur-Sultan, is hosting the 2019 Knowledge Sharing Programme Regional Seminar in Eurasia, which provides Kazakhstan with an opportunity to go over social and economic issues Eurasia faces as well as a platform to exchange views with regional, global and Korean experts, Strategy2050.kz correspondent reports.

Korean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ary to the Republic of Kazakhstan Mr. Kim Dae-Sik is among those present, who in his welcoming remarks stressed the visit of Korean President Moon Jae-in to Kazakhstan.

“This year is special. As you know, in April we had a very successful visit of President Moon Jae-in to Kazakhstan, who talked with Kazakh President Tokayev. They had very successful discussions”, the Korean ambassador said.

He also added that the Korean President had shared his intention to share Korea’s experience in economic development in the Eurasian continent.

“The two leaders will continue to cooperate to share our economic experience. Today’s seminar is very useful. We can exchange our views on how to improve our skills. I think this is a very good opportunity. Yesterday, In Nur-Sultan we had the international event – the 4th Meeting of Speakers of Eurasian Parliaments. 25 years ago first Kazakh President Nursultan Nazarbayev had mentioned about the Eurasian integration concept in Moscow”, Mr. Kim Dae-Sik said.

He sees the seminar’s objective in overcoming some difficulties in the will of Eurasian leaders to cooperate, expressing the hope that the seminar that centers on the fields of investment and trade will bring about successful discussions.

“As Korean Ambassador to Kazakhstan, I think your country is a very dynamic economy, especially among other Central Asian economies. Your input and effort are very much appreciated to the programme”, he concluded.

2019 KSP Regional Seminar is held each year.
